HERA Platform Officially Launches with 105 TOPS AI Edge Computing

Real-time Robotics today announced the production launch of HERA, the company’s flagship enterprise drone platform. HERA represents a fundamental leap in autonomous aerial intelligence, combining a backpack-portable form factor with 105 TOPS of onboard AI computing power, more than any competing platform in its class.

The platform carries up to four simultaneous payloads totaling 30 lbs, enabling operators to run EO/IR, LiDAR, multispectral, and custom sensors in a single flight. All AI processing happens at the edge, eliminating cloud latency and data security concerns.

"HERA is the result of a decade of full-stack engineering," said the founding team. "We designed every component in-house, from the carbon fiber airframe to the AI platform, because mission-critical operations demand zero compromise."

HERA is NDAA Section 889 compliant and is already in evaluation with multiple U.S. government agencies and enterprise customers.
